E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
可选类型
Swift2.0(4)
可选类型
可选类型
什么是
可选类型
?可以被赋予nil值的类型,在类型后添加问号(?)如Int类型的值为整型数,但不太好表示“空”的含义,Int?可以赋值为整型数和nil值如:varage:Int?
ymanmeng123
·
2016-03-03 10:41
iOS
App
Xcode
Swift2.0
Swift2.0(4)
可选类型
可选类型
什么是
可选类型
? 可以被赋予nil值的类型,在类型后添加问号(?) 如Int类型的值为整型数,但不太好表示“空”的含义,Int?
ymanmeng123
·
2016-03-03 10:41
ios
xcode
APP
swift
Swift2.0
可选类型
swift
可选类型
可选类型
:我们先看看如下代码:varn1:Int=10n1=nil//编译错误letstr:String=nil//编译错误Int和String类型不能接受nil的,但程序运行过程中有时被复制给nil是在所难免的
法斗斗
·
2016-03-03 10:00
swift学习--控制流
判断if判断普通条件判断funcdemo2(){ leturl=NSURL(string:"www.baidu.com") //if判断url
可选类型
有没有值 ifurl!
kaqijiang
·
2016-03-03 00:00
swift
控制流
《从零开始学Swift》学习笔记(Day 28)――总结使用问号(?)和感叹号(!)
转载请注明:关东升的博客 在使用
可选类型
和可选链时,多次使用了问号(?)和感叹号(!),但是它们的含义是不同的,下面我来详细说明一下。 1.
可选类型
中的问号(?)
tony_guan
·
2016-03-02 09:52
学习笔记
swift
从零开始
《从零开始学Swift》学习笔记(Day 28)——总结使用问号(?)和感叹号(!)
转载请注明:关东升的博客在使用
可选类型
和可选链时,多次使用了问号(?)和感叹号(!),但是它们的含义是不同的,下面我来详细说明一下。1.
可选类型
中的问号(?)
tony关东升
·
2016-03-02 09:52
从零开始学Swift
Swift书
Swift开发
《从零开始学Swift》学习笔
《从零开始学Swift》学习笔记(Day 27)――
可选类型
转载请注明:关东升的博客
可选类型
:我们先看看如下代码:var n1: Int = 10 n1 = nil //编译错误 let str: String = nil //编译错误
tony_guan
·
2016-03-02 09:32
学习笔记
swift
从零开始
《从零开始学Swift》学习笔记(Day 27)——
可选类型
转载请注明:关东升的博客
可选类型
:我们先看看如下代码:var n1: Int = 10n1 = nil //编译错误 let str: String = nil //编译错误Int
tony关东升
·
2016-03-02 09:32
从零开始学Swift
Swift书
Swift开发
《从零开始学Swift》学习笔
《从零开始学Swift》学习笔记(Day 26)――可选链
这些符号都与
可选类型
和可选链相关,下面来看看可选链。 可选链:类图: 它们之间是典型的关联关系类图。这些类一般都是实体类,实体类是系统中的人、事、物。
tony_guan
·
2016-03-02 09:01
学习笔记
swift
从零开始
《从零开始学Swift》学习笔记(Day 26)——可选链
这些符号都与
可选类型
和可选链相关,下面来看看可选链。可选链:类图:它们之间是典型的关联关系类图。这些类一般都是实体类,实体类是系统中的人、事、物。
tony关东升
·
2016-03-02 09:01
从零开始学Swift
Swift书
Swift开发
《从零开始学Swift》学习笔
《从零开始学Swift》学习笔记(Day 12)――说几个特殊运算符
:用来声明
可选类型
。 感叹号(!):对
可选类型
值进行强制拆封。 箭头(->):说明函数或方法返回值类型。 冒号运算符(:):用于字典集合分割“键值”对。
tony_guan
·
2016-02-29 17:44
学习笔记
swift
从零开始
构造器(一)
实例存储属性的类型为
可选类型
,这样默认分配nil作为初始值提供构造器为实例存储属性分配初始值很明显,今天我们学习的是第三者无参构造器构造器后面括号里没有参数st
IT_DS
·
2016-02-29 15:00
存储
实例
构造器
结构
init
构造器(一)
实例存储属性的类型为
可选类型
,这样默认分配nil作为初始值提供构造器为实例存储属性分配初始值很明显,今天我们学习的是第三者无参构造器构造器后面括号里没有参数st
IT_DS
·
2016-02-29 15:00
存储
实例
构造器
结构
init
可选链
学习可选链的前提我们要对
可选类型
进行复习,可以参考我之前写的这篇博客Object-C—>Swift之(二)
可选类型
个人理解可选链建立在
可选类型
的基础上,
可选类型
操作的是某个变量,而可选链操作的是某几个类围绕今天是猴年正月二十一为题材
IT_DS
·
2016-02-28 20:00
swift
可选类型
可选链
可选链
学习可选链的前提我们要对
可选类型
进行复习,可以参考我之前写的这篇博客Object-C—>Swift之(二)
可选类型
个人理解可选链建立在
可选类型
的基础上,
可选类型
操作的是某个变量,而可选链操作的是某几个类围绕今天是猴年正月二十一为题材
IT_DS
·
2016-02-28 20:00
swift
可选类型
可选链
SpringMVC Controller 返回值的
可选类型
springmvc支持如下的返回方式:ModelAndView,Model,ModelMap,Map,View,String,void。ModelAndView@RequestMapping("/hello") publicModelAndViewhelloWorld(){ Stringmessage="HelloWorld,Spring3.x!"; returnnewModelAndVie
三流程序猿
·
2016-02-17 20:00
Swift基本语法之闭包
Swift基本语法之初体验-常量变量-数据类型Swift基本语法之逻辑分支Swift基本语法之循环Swift基本语法之字符串Swift基本语法之数组和字典Swift基本语法之元组和
可选类型
Swift基本语法之函数
coderwhy
·
2016-02-06 21:15
Swift基本语法之类的使用
Swift中类的使用Swift基本语法之初体验-常量变量-数据类型Swift基本语法之逻辑分支Swift基本语法之循环Swift基本语法之字符串Swift基本语法之数组和字典Swift基本语法之元组和
可选类型
coderwhy
·
2016-01-23 13:23
Swift语法基础入门四(构造函数, 懒加载)
Swift语法基础入门四(构造函数,懒加载)存储属性具备存储功能,和OC中普通属性一样//Swfit要求我们在创建对象时必须给所有的属性初始化//如果没办法保证在构造方法中初始化属性,可以将属性变为
可选类型
演员i
·
2016-01-20 00:00
Object-C--->Swift之(三)nil合并运算符、范围运算符
注意这里有两个必须条件:1.a必须是
可选类型
的。2.b的类型必须要和a的强制解析后的类型一致。其实上边的代码还可以转换成C语言的三目运算:letc=a!=nil?a!:b
IT_DS
·
2016-01-14 12:00
swift
合并
合并运算符
范围运算符
Object-C--->Swift之(二)
可选类型
就这样
可选类型
就呼之欲出!定义:在任何类型后面紧
IT_DS
·
2016-01-13 21:00
swift
可选类型
swift学习日记(一)
b将对
可选类型
a进行空判断,若a包含一个值就进行解封,否则返回一个默认值b但注意需要满足:a为一个optional(可选)类型;默认值b的类型必须与a存储值的类型保持一致闭区间运算符:闭区间运算符(a.
哲歌
·
2015-12-30 23:48
Swift基本语法(一)
//声明为
可选类型
varmyAge:IntletNAME="Jake" //常量的声明typealiasAge=UInt //为UInt声明了一别名为Agevarage_1:Agevar
tianmaxingkong_
·
2015-12-29 11:00
SpringMVC Controller 返回值的
可选类型
原文地址:http://www.cnblogs.com/xiepeixing/p/4243801.html 感谢原作者!springmvc支持如下的返回方式:ModelAndView,Model,ModelMap,Map,View,String,void。 ModelAndView@RequestMapping("/hello") publicModelAndViewhelloWorld(){ S
smok56888
·
2015-12-28 14:00
spring
141,整数类型
1,Swift常用的数据类型有>Int,Float,Double,Bool,Character,String>Array,Dictionary,元组类型(Tuple),
可选类型
(Optional)>数据类型的首字母是大写的
dreamljs
·
2015-12-25 10:47
Swift
Swift基本语法之元组和
可选类型
Swift基本语法之初体验-常量变量-数据类型Swift基本语法之逻辑分支Swift基本语法之循环Swift基本语法之字符串Swift基本语法之数组和字典元组元组的介绍元组是Swift中特有的,OC中并没有相关类型它是什么呢?它是一种数据结构,在数学中应用广泛类似于数组或者字典可以用于定义一组数据组成元组类型的数据可以称为“元素”元组的定义元组的常见写法//使用元组描述一个人的信息("1001",
coderwhy
·
2015-12-21 19:21
springMVC对于controller处理方法返回值的
可选类型
简介对于springMVC处理方法支持支持一系列的返回方式:ModelAndViewModelModelMapMapViewStringVoid具体介绍详细介绍每一个返回类型的各个特点;ModelAndView@RequestMapping(method=RequestMethod.GET) public ModelAndView index(){ ModelAndView
java程序猿
·
2015-12-17 14:05
springMVC
springMVC对于controller处理方法返回值的
可选类型
简介对于springMVC处理方法支持支持一系列的返回方式:ModelAndViewModelModelMapMapViewStringVoid具体介绍详细介绍每一个返回类型的各个特点;ModelAndView@RequestMapping(method=RequestMethod.GET) public ModelAndView index(){ ModelAndView
java程序猿
·
2015-12-17 14:05
springMVC
swift ! 和 ? 的学习
//只声明没做初始化赋值说明当前name是nil这说明name 是一个
可选类型
,name可能是个字符串也可能是nil (这个nil跟OC中的nil不同,不是指针,而是表示值不存在),1.那么调用方法、属性
ACM_Someone like you
·
2015-12-11 17:00
mongodb 基本指令学习 (2)
db.collectionname.find(, ) 可选 类型文档 文档的过滤条件
可选类型
文档 对结果进行字段的匹配 {字段1:,字段2:...}
icantunderstand
·
2015-12-05 19:00
Swift -6 面向对象基础(下)
,不需要强制解析Swift的所有类型默认不能接受nil值,但是定义成
可选类型
就可以了,可选链就是用来处理
可选类型
的属性的,下标和方法,可以代替强制解析可选链用于处理
可选类型
的属性.方法和下标使用可选链代替强制解析调用方法调用下标创建三个关联类
Devin_Zhan
·
2015-11-30 23:56
iOS之Swift专题分享
Swift -6 面向对象基础(下)
,不需要强制解析Swift的所有类型默认不能接受nil值,但是定义成
可选类型
就可以了,可选链就是用来处理
可选类型
的属性的,下标和方法,可以代替强制解析可选链用于处理
可选类型
的属性.方法和下标使用可选链代替强制解析调用方法调用下标创建三个关联类
Devin_Zhan
·
2015-11-30 23:56
iOS之Swift专题分享
Swift -5 面向对象基础(中)
结构体常量与实例属性3.定义计算属性4.setter方法5.属性观察者存储属性:存储在类.结构体里的变量或者常量分为:实例存储属性.类型存储属性所有的存储属性必须显示的指定初始值,在定义时或者构造器当中指定
可选类型
的存储属性可以不指定初始值结构体中实例存储属性的规则
Devin_Zhan
·
2015-11-30 23:00
面向对象
swift
Swift -6 面向对象基础(下)
,不需要强制解析Swift的所有类型默认不能接受nil值,但是定义成
可选类型
就可以了,可选链就是用来处理
可选类型
的属性的,下标和方法,可以代替强制解析可选链用于处理
可选类型
的属性.方法和下标使用可选链代替强制解析调用方法调用下标创建三个关联类
Devin_Zhan
·
2015-11-30 23:00
面向对象
swift
实现可打印内容的 try? 和 try!
运算符在
可选类型
(optionals)和错误处理机制中抛出error转换为输出nil结果值之间建立了桥接。这样你就可以使用guard语句和条件绑定,只关注处理成功的用例(case)。///try?
SwiftGG翻译组
·
2015-11-27 00:00
swift
Swift -5 面向对象基础(中)
结构体常量与实例属性3.定义计算属性4.setter方法5.属性观察者存储属性:存储在类.结构体里的变量或者常量分为:实例存储属性.类型存储属性所有的存储属性必须显示的指定初始值,在定义时或者构造器当中指定
可选类型
的存储属性可以不指定初始值结构体中实例存储属性的规则
Devin_Zhan
·
2015-11-25 21:30
iOS之Swift专题分享
Swift -5 面向对象基础(中)
结构体常量与实例属性3.定义计算属性4.setter方法5.属性观察者存储属性:存储在类.结构体里的变量或者常量分为:实例存储属性.类型存储属性所有的存储属性必须显示的指定初始值,在定义时或者构造器当中指定
可选类型
的存储属性可以不指定初始值结构体中实例存储属性的规则
Devin_Zhan
·
2015-11-25 21:30
iOS之Swift专题分享
swift中的
可选类型
1.swift中的
可选类型
变量表示这个变量可能有值,也可能为空。你可能会想这个直接用一个指针不就搞定了么?但swift是不支持指针的.
Sunny孙宁
·
2015-11-22 21:00
Swift -1 语言基础
Swift简介:1.Swift支持所有C和Objective-C的基本类型,支持面向过程和面向对象的编程机制2.Swift提供了两种功能强劲的集合类型:数组和字典3.元祖4.
可选类型
5.Swift是一种类型安全的语言
Devin_Zhan
·
2015-11-16 19:47
iOS之Swift专题分享
Swift -1 语言基础
Swift简介:1.Swift支持所有C和Objective-C的基本类型,支持面向过程和面向对象的编程机制2.Swift提供了两种功能强劲的集合类型:数组和字典3.元祖4.
可选类型
5.Swift是一种类型安全的语言
Devin_Zhan
·
2015-11-16 19:00
面向对象
xcode
swift
Swift入门教程:基本语法(四)
可选类型
·
2015-11-13 23:46
swift
《Swift by Tutorials》学习笔记(第二章)
可选类型
(Optionals) 根据之前的知识,当我们需要声明一个变量的时候,我们可以这么做: var str = "Hello, playground" 这样,我们在声明的时候同时指定了初值
·
2015-11-13 16:13
swift
swift之
可选类型
可选类型
用来表示值缺失的情况C和OC中没有
可选类型
这个概念//
可选类型
定义 varx:Int?
lvdezhou
·
2015-11-13 13:00
可选类型
Swift(十七、可选链)
十七、可选链1、写于前-概念梳理1.1、
可选类型
使用时需要解包,解包时需要判断是否为nil,常用if语句判断,再去访问其属性或方法,否则会运行错误。当
可选类型
访问其属性还是可选时,即多层可选
Zsk_Zane
·
2015-11-11 22:09
Swift
Swift(十七、可选链)
十七、可选链1、写于前-概念梳理1.1、
可选类型
使用时需要解包,解包时需要判断是否为nil,常用if语句判断,再去访问其属性或方法,否则会运行错误。当
可选类型
访问其属性还是可选时,即多层可选
Zsk_Zane
·
2015-11-11 22:00
swift
ios开发
可选链
可空链式调用
多层链接
xcode 4.2 新建工程模板详解
在Xcode4.2中新建一个工程,有三个大类可选: 1.Application: 在这个类别下面,你可以看到下面8种
可选类型
下面对这些工程一一说明: 1.Document-Based
·
2015-11-02 18:58
xcode
IOS开发之旅(二)----xcode_4.2_新建工程模板详解
在Xcode4.2中新建一个工程,有三个大类可选: 1.Application: 在这个类别下面,你可以看到下面8种
可选类型
下面对这些工程一一说明
·
2015-11-02 18:05
xcode
angularjs reset input file and filter file
function(inputElem){angular.element(inputElem).val(null);});2.设置选择文件限制只能选择xls或xlsx后缀文件accept=".xls,.xlsx"其他
可选类型
参考
lihaiming
·
2015-10-31 11:00
AngularJS
File
input
清空上传文件
Swift(三、元组-
可选类型
及其解析)
三、元组-
可选类型
及其解析1、元组a、元组将任意数据类型组装成一个复合值(不要求相同类型)b、元组在作为函数返回值时特别适用,可以为函数返回更多的信息1.1、元组的创建及访问//可以理解为k
Zsk_Zane
·
2015-10-30 16:00
swift
元组
ios开发
可选类型
Swift学习笔记
let声明常量(常量不可修改),var声明变量 4:字符串用""(双引号扩着) 注:Swift是类型安全语言, 1:数据类型 常见的数据类型:比其他语言多了 元组(Tuple),
可选类型
·
2015-10-30 14:45
swift
上一页
11
12
13
14
15
16
17
18
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他